respecterre‧spect‧er /rɪˈspektə $ -ər/ noun Examples
EXAMPLES FROM THE CORPUS
  • But nature is no respecter of rights, and around 10 % of the population has had this right compromised by biology.
  • Child abuse, wife battering, family break-up, delinquency and alcoholism are no respecters of beautiful surroundings.
  • Credibility is no respecter of good looks.
  • She was no respecter of persons and never thought before she spoke.
  • They were not respecters of party lines and the last two in particular were widely distrusted among parliamentary colleagues.
  • Unfortunately they are no respecters of persons or property as car owners find to their dismay.

1be no respecter of persons formal to affect all people in the same way, whether or not they are rich or powerful:  Disease is no respecter of persons.2be a respecter of something to have respect for something such as a law or organization:  She is a respecter of the rights of all religious groups.
